Abstract
The genus Caeculus Dufour (Prostigmata, Caeculidae) contains 19 previously described species, most of which are found in North America, and for which no comprehensive phylogenetic treatment exists. Here, one new species from Alberta, Canada, is described: Caeculus cassiopeiae Bernard & Lumley, sp. nov., and another caeculid known to be present in Canada is documented. The new species is characterized within the genus with a character state matrix, from which an updated key is produced. A systematic analysis of all 20 species based on morphological and geographical distribution traits obtained from literature represents the first phylogenetic review of the genus. Character states of species (females) used for morphological comparison and cladistic analysis. Row number aligns to column number in Table 1. A setal pair refers to two setae in symmetry on either side of the mid-sagittal plane. An excluded seta is denoted by “excl.” Size character is excluded from analysis.
| Character | States |
|---|---|
| 1. Distribution | 0 = Old World, 1 = SE North America, 2 = SW North America, 3 = N Central North America, 4 = NW North America, 5 = Western Australia |
| 2. Aspidosomal Pa setae | 0 = absent, 1 = 1 pair, 2 = 2 pairs, 3 = 3 pairs |
| 3. Aspidosomal Pm setae | 0 = absent, 1 = 1 pair, 2 = 2 pairs |
| 4. Aspidosomal Pp setae | 0 = 1 pair, 1 = 2 pairs, 2 = 3 pairs, 3 = 5 pairs |
| 5. Anterior margin of aspidosoma acuminate | 0 = no, 1 = yes |
| 6. Anterior margin of aspidosoma notched | 0 = no, 1 = yes |
| 7. Centrodorsal opisthosoma a setae (excl. as) | 0 = 1 pair, 1 = 2 pairs |
| 8. Unpaired medial as seta present | 0 = no, 1 = yes |
| 9. Centrodorsal opisthosoma b setae (excl. bs) | 0 = 1 pair, 1 = 2 pairs, 2 = 3 pairs |
| 10. Unpaired medial bs seta present | 0 = no, 1 = yes |
| 11. Centrodorsal opisthosoma c setae (excl. cs) | 0 = 1 pair, 1 = 2 pairs |
| 12. Unpaired medial cs seta present | 0 = no, 1 = yes |
| 13. Laterodorsal opisthosoma a setae | 0 = 1 seta, 1 = 2 setae, 2 = 3 setae |
| 14. Laterodorsal opisthosoma b setae | 0 = 1 seta, 1 = 2 setae , 2 = 3 setae |
| 15. Laterodorsal opisthosoma c setae | 0 = 1 seta, 1 = 2 setae, 2 = 3 setae |
| 16. Mediodorsal opisthosomal sclerites fused | 0 = no, 1 = yes |
| 17. Mediodorsal opisthosomal d setae (excl. ds) | 0 = 1 pair, 1 = 2 pairs, 2 = 3 pairs, 3 = 4 pairs |
| 18. Unpaired medial ds seta present | 0 = no, 1 = yes |
| 19. Posterior opisthosomal e setae (excl. es) | 0 = 1 pair, 1 = 2 pairs, 2 = 3 pairs, 3 = 4 pairs, 4 = 5 pairs, 5 = 8 pairs |
| 20. Unpaired medial es seta present | 0 = no, 1 = yes |
| 21. Pluriposterior sclerite h setae (excl. hs) | 0 = absent, 1 = 1 pair, 2 = 2 pairs |
| 22. Unpaired medial hs seta present | 0 = no, 1 = yes |
| 23. Aggenital + ventral sclerite setae | 0 = 2 pairs, 1 = 4 pairs, 2 = 6 pairs, 3 = 8 pairs, 4 = 9 pairs, 5 = 10 pairs, 6 = 12 pairs |
| 24. Progenital valve setae | 0 = 3 pairs, 1 = 4 pairs, 2 = 5 pairs, 3 = 6 pairs, 4 = 7 pairs, 5 = 8 pairs |
| 25. Adanal setae | 0 = absent, 1 = 1 pair, 2 = 2 pairs, 3 = 3 pairs |
| 26. Pseudanal Ps setae | 0 = 2 pairs, 1 = 3 pairs, 2 = 4 pairs |
| 27. Unpaired medial seta posterior to anus | 0 = no, 1 = yes |
| 28. Trochanter I anterolateral setae | 0 = 1 seta, 1 = 2 setae, 2 = 3 setae, 3 = 4 setae |
| 29. Trochanter I anterolateral setal shape | 0 = clavate, 1 = spiniform |
| 30. Posterior/dorsal trochanter I setae | 0 = 1 seta, 1 = 2 setae, 2 = 3 setae, 3 = 4 setae, 4 = 5 setae, 5 = 8 setae |
| 31. Basifemur I anteroventral rake setal shape | 0 = spiniform, 1 = subclavate |
| 32. Telofemur I anteroventral rake setae | 0 = 1 seta, 1 = 2 setae |
| 33. Telofemur I anteroventral rake setal shape | 0 = spiniform, 1 = subclavate |
| 34. Femur I posteroventral rake setae | 0 = absent, 1 = 1 seta |
| 35. Genu I anteroventral rake/spiniform setae | 0 = 1 seta, 1 = 2 setae, 2 = 3 setae, 3 = 5 setae |
| 36. Genu I posteroventral rake setae | 0 = absent, 1 = 1 seta, 2 = 2 setae, 3 = 3 setae, 4 = 4 setae |
| 37. Tibia I anteroventral rake/spiniform setae | 0 = 2 setae, 1 = 3 setae, 2 = 4 setae, 3 = 5 setae, 4 = 6 setae |
| 38. Tibia I posteroventral rake/spiniform setae | 0 = absent, 1 = 1 seta, 2 = 2 setae, 3 = 3 setae, 4 = 4 setae, 5 = 5 setae |
| 39. Tarsus I anterior rake-like setae | 0 = absent, 1 = 3 setae, 2 = 4 setae, 3 = 5 setae |
| 40. Trochanter III anterolateral setae | 0 = absent, 1 = 1 seta, 2 = 2 setae, 3 = 3 setae |
| 41. Trochanter III anterolateral setal shape | 0 = clavate, 1 = spiniform |
| 42. Posterior/dorsal trochanter III setae | 0 = 1 seta, 1 = 2 setae, 2 = 3 setae, 3 = 4 setae |
| 43. Bothridial bt seta on tarsus I | 0 = no, 1 = yes |
| 44. Bothridial bt seta on tarsus II | 0 = no, 1 = yes |
| 45. Bothridial bt seta on tarsus III | 0 = no, 1 = yes |
| 46. Bothridial bt seta on tarsus IV | 0 = no, 1 = yes |
| 47. Dark sclerites on dorsal idiosoma in adults | 0 = no, 1 = yes |
| 48. Body encrusted with cemented particles | 0 = no, 1 = yes |
| 49. Tarsal claws unequal in size | 0 = no, 1 = yes |
| 50. Aspidosoma projecting anteriorly over gnathosoma in lateral view | 0 = no, 1 = yes |
| 51. Body length (mm) | 0 = ≤ 0.90, 1 = 0.91 – 1.29, 2 = 1.30 – 1.59, 3 = 1.60 – 2.00 |
